Concept

Tim Brown Racing, LLC (TBR) was founded in 2006 by NFL legend Tim Brown with the intention to fill NASCAR's singualr void of cultural diversity. In order to continually develop the largest fan base in professional sports, NASCAR has embarked on a mission to look outside its traditional target audience to find ways to embrace minority markets such as women, youth, Hispanics, Asians and African Americans. Recognizing this, and the Tim Brown brand's rich 20-year roots in the public eye TBR will leverage his celebrity capital as part of our strategic plan to be the team that provides the highest ROI to sponsors in NASCAR.

TBR's objective is to combine exciting championship-calibur race operations, along with celebrity-leveraged community programs, to bring millions of active new fans to NASCAR. Combining the excitement of NASCAR racing, the star power of celebrity connections and consumer awareness programs surrounding the sponsor's brand, TBR will deliver the highest possible ROI to our partners.

TBR Management

TBR has contracted Dale Earnhardt Inc (DEI) to manage our race operations. DEI has a proven track record for fielding championship teams for over 20 years including 3 Daytona 500 victories, 4 Busch Series Championships and wins in one or more races each year since 2000. We understand the need to partner with excellence to quickly and efficiently become a force in the NASCAR circuit.

Tim Brown

Tim Brown is Chairman of Locker 81, Inc. While completing his Bachelor’s degree in Business from the University of Notre Dame, Tim Brown also won the Heisman Trophy and went on to spend a record-setting 17 year career in the NFL. During his career, his on-field excellence was mirrored by an off-field career in various successful ventures including telecom, internet services, sports apparel and management. Tim Brown has served as a board member for VSI, is the national spokesman for Athletes and Entertainers for Kids, 911 for Kids and is a trustee for Victory Temple Church of God in Christ.

Sheldon Freeman

Sheldon Freeman is Vice President and General Manager of Tim Brown Racing. Sheldon Freeman has a decade of Fortune 500 sales and management experience which includes positions with companies such as General Electric (GE), Xerox Corporation, and Agfa Healthcare. Sheldon Freeman is a graduate of GE's America's Sales Training Program (ASTP), and a certified Six Sigma Green Belt. Sheldon Freeman's career with large corporations includes new business development in excess of $45 Million. Sheldon Freeman has also spearheaded a unique youth advocacy program which primarily focused on "at risk students". Sheldon Freeman's efforts helped motivate and fund more than 60 of these youth to successfully enter college over a seven year period.

Donald Kelly

Donald Kellyis Director and Vice President of Locker 81, Inc. Donald Kelly has been a lifelong advisor and business partner to Tim Brown. He is also the Executive Director of The Tim Brown Foundation where he oversees the foundation’s day-to-day operations, sponsor relations and events.

Joe Abraham

Joe Abraham is Founder and Managing Director of En Corpus Group, LLC. Joe Abraham oversees business strategy and operations across the Tim Brown Companies. Since 1997, he has been involved from incubation to sale of companies in Direct Response Marketing, E-Commerce, Consumer Products and Sales Training. Those companies have experienced a combined $350 Million in revenues. En Corpus Group acts as a venture catalyst and business advisor to startup and emerging growth companies. Joe Abraham's past clients have included Honda, Mercedes Benz, Carnival Cruise Lines, Trimlife Health Services and Holiday Systems International.
